Georgetown to Idaho Springs Half Marathon

Time

6:00 AM TO 5:00 PM

Location

Co Rd 306, Georgetown

Details

The Georgetown to Idaho Springs Half Marathon is a 13.1 mile Colorado Runner’s Must-Do. This iconic Half Marathon is one of the most pleasurable races in the western US. The point-to-point course is a scenic and gently rolling downhill mountain course that winds down the Clear Creek Valley -- starting at an elevation of 8,500ft. at Georgetown Lake and ending at an elevation of 7,500ft. in Idaho Springs, with one hill of a finish!

This event is hosted by the Clear Creek Booster Club, and it is planned by parent volunteers. Proceeds from the GTIS Half Marathon go directly to supporting middle school and high school students in Clear Creek County.

    Annual Georgetown Bighorn Sheep Festival

    Time

    10:00 AM TO 6:00 PM

    Location

    600 6th Street, Georgetown

    Details

    2025 Annual Georgetown Bighorn Sheep Festival is November 8th ~ This free festival always takes place the 2nd Saturday in November.

    Join the Historic Town of Georgetown and Colorado Parks & Wildlife for the Annual Georgetown Bighorn Sheep Festival from @ 10:00 am - 3:00 pm.

    There will be children’s activities, crafts, music, wildlife programs, hikes, tours and so much more!

    Be sure to stop by the Bighorn Sheep Viewing Station at the Georgetown Gateway Visitor Center as trained volunteers with binoculars and spotting scopes help viewers locate the head-banging sheep and offer a brief lesson on the animals!

    Bighorns may be noticed from the highway, but, for the safety of both people and wildlife, please view sheep from the Georgetown Gateway Visitor Center and viewing station.

    Georgetown Christmas Market

    Location

    600 6th Street, Georgetown

    Details

    December 6th, 7th, 13th and 14th - 2025 Annual Georgetown Christmas Market

    Each December the town of Georgetown transforms for two weekends into a bustling Christmas scene reminiscent of Christmas of long ago. Thousands come to this tiny mountain town to experience a traditional holiday where Christmas hasn’t changed in 100 years: roasted chestnuts, holiday shopping, horse-drawn wagon rides through historic Georgetown, and wonderful sights and smells. Visitors enjoy appearances by St. Nicholas in his traditional dress and the daily procession of the Santa Lucia. Carolers in Victorian costume, dancers, and other family entertainment provide hours of memorable performances. Adorned with lights and Christmas greenery and blanketed with snow, the quaint, historic town of Georgetown, Colorado has been a Christmas tradition for generations of Colorado families. This year we hope you will begin making it a tradition of your own!!

    The Georgetown Christmas Market is held annually on the first and second full weekends of December. Admission is FREE. Christmas Market features an outdoor European marketplace with handcrafted gifts in addition to Georgetown’s charming year-round shopping experience. Beautiful and unique shops showcase Christmas ornaments and decorations, Victorian items for the home, art, Colorado wine, rare books, jewelry, exquisite clothing, antiques, and gifts. The Market will also feature food vendors in addition to our fabulous local restaurants.

    Christmas Market Museum Tours offer a relaxed way to see the Hamill House, Hotel de Paris and Energy Museums and Georgetown Heritage Center. Docents are on hand to give information or answer questions, but guests may stroll through the properties at their leisure to enjoy the holiday decor. Prices vary.

    This event will take place on 6th Street in Historic Downtown Georgetown, Colorado.
